Andreeva’s Unstoppable Journey
Andreeva’s journey to the top has been nothing short of meteoric. Her performance at Roland Garros in 2024, where she reached the semi-finals, catapulted her into the global spotlight. In 2025, she has continued to build on that success, securing WTA 1000 titles in Dubai and Indian Wells, and climbing to a career-high ranking of world No. 6 in singles.
Born on April 29, 2007, in Krasnoyarsk, Russia, Andreeva began playing tennis at the age of six. Her talent was evident early on, and she quickly rose through the junior ranks, becoming the world No. 1 junior player on May 29, 2023.
Key Highlights of Andreeva’s Career
- Former World No. 1 Junior: Andreeva reached the pinnacle of junior tennis, showcasing her potential from a young age.
- 2023 Australian Open Girls’ Finalist: She displayed her competitive spirit by reaching the final, losing a hard-fought match to Alina Korneeva.
- Multiple ITF Titles: Andreeva made history by winning multiple titles at the ITF W60 level or above before turning 16, a feat unmatched in the history of the ITF World Tennis Tour.
- 2024 French Open Semi-Finalist: At just 17, Andreeva reached her first Grand Slam semi-final, defeating World No. 2 Aryna Sabalenka in the quarter-finals.
- 2024 Olympic Silver Medalist: Partnering with Diana Shnaider, Andreeva secured a silver medal in women’s doubles at the Paris Olympics.
- 2025 WTA 1000 Champion: Andreeva became the youngest player to win a WTA 1000 title, triumphing in Dubai and later Indian Wells.
The “Lucky Charm”
During her third-round match at the 2025 French Open against Yulia Putintseva, Andreeva revealed that a “lucky charm” had been instrumental in her success. A young girl had given her a gift before the match, and Andreeva felt it brought her good fortune. This heartwarming moment highlights Andreeva’s connection with her fans and the positive energy that surrounds her.
In the past, Andreeva has also mentioned Andy Murray as a source of inspiration and a “lucky charm.” After Murray won a Challenger event, Andreeva congratulated him, and his response wishing her luck at Roland Garros seemed to coincide with her strong performance.
During the 2024 French Open, after claiming her first senior grand slam victory, the then sixteen-year-old Andreeva said: “When you’re here and take a lunch with all these stars, you see Andy Murray, you see his face and he’s so beautiful in life, he is so amazing”.
Matching Hingis and Sharapova
Andreeva’s achievements at the 2025 French Open have placed her in the company of tennis legends. Her 30th victory of the year before the conclusion of the tournament is a milestone previously reached by Maria Sharapova and Martina Hingis, solidifying her status as one of the youngest players to achieve such a feat.
Martina Hingis: A Young Prodigy
Martina Hingis burst onto the tennis scene as a teenager, achieving remarkable success at a young age. Hingis became the youngest Grand Slam singles champion of the 20th century when she won the Australian Open in 1997 at the age of 16. She went on to win multiple Grand Slam titles and reach the No. 1 ranking in the world.
Maria Sharapova: A Force to Be Reckoned With
Maria Sharapova, known for her powerful game and on-court presence, also made a significant impact early in her career. Sharapova won Wimbledon in 2004 at the age of 17, signaling the start of her reign as one of the sport’s top players. She achieved the world No. 1 ranking and completed a career Grand Slam, winning all four major titles.

Coaching and Influences
Andreeva’s career has been shaped by the guidance of experienced coaches. Conchita Martínez, a former world No. 2, has been instrumental in Andreeva’s development, helping her find balance and maintain a positive mindset on the court.
Andreeva has also expressed admiration for Maria Sharapova, who has offered her support and guidance. The opportunity to connect with a former champion has undoubtedly been valuable for the young player.
